Battle of Quiberon Bay, c1765. Artist: Francis Swaine

Battle of Quiberon Bay, c1765. Fought between the fleets of Britain and France, the naval Battle of Quiberon Bay took place off the French coast on 20 November 1759 during the Seven Years War. The British victory scuppered French plans for an invasion of Britain and signalled the rise of the Royal Navy as the worlds dominant sea power. From Old Naval Prints, by Charles N. Robinson & Geoffrey Holme. [The Studio Limited, London, 1924]

This print captures the intensity and grandeur of the Battle of Quiberon Bay, a pivotal naval engagement that took place in 1759. Painted by Francis Swaine, this artwork showcases the clash between the British and French fleets off the coast of France during the Seven Years War. The battle was a turning point for both nations, as it thwarted French plans to invade Britain and solidified the Royal Navy's dominance on the world stage.
